Output 4c312caca2321c538127a88258e7a3cc19a1dbe2ac98afa84fc2cb73d2c1a73c:0

value
1052376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3baaa9de43bfbc29e72098732e7260f136571e14 OP_EQUAL
address
378WEmnPJzjQYBxDvYGU8VxasrVEe7zb9T
transaction
4c312caca2321c538127a88258e7a3cc19a1dbe2ac98afa84fc2cb73d2c1a73c
spent
true